Thermal Shock Chamber

Application
Thermal Shock Chamber are designed for air-to-air thermal shock tests, to test components or equipment automatically submitting them to rapid temp. changes & are mainly used in spare research programs, Defense Laboratories, Q.C & R & D  Testing Laboratories etc.

Construction :
The Chamber has a vertical design, the hot cabinet located over the cold one, Fabricated on heavy angular structure with outer construction of CRCAIMS sheets with non-contaminant epoxy powder coated, interior & the basket are of AISI S.S304, two individual doors fitted with silicon gasket for cooling chamber & heating chamber.

Air Circulation :
Forced air circulation is provided within each chamber which ensures uniform temperatures, the fans are stopped automatically during the baskets transfer to reduce interaction between the cabinets.

Heating System:
Imported Encolite heaters provides heating for the hot chamber.

Refrigeration Systems :
Hermetically sealed 2 or 3 staged compressors are used for sufficient cooling, with cooling coils, condensing coils, Low pressure cut off, High pressure cut off, oil separators, fan motor, Dryers, filters, Headers, Cascade system,
Copper coiling outside as well as inside the chamber etc.

Refrigerant :
CFC Free 134 for the first stage & CFC free SUVA - 95 for the second & third stages.

Working :
A pneumatically drive basket passes the between the upside & down between the two cabinets after the regular interval fixed in the system.

Thermal Shock Chamber

Specification :
Cold Chamber Temp. range : -20 °C/ -35 °C / -40 °C / -80 °C.
Accuracy : +/- 1 °C.
Hot Chamber Temp. Range : + 200 °C.
Accuracy : +/- 1°C.
Chamber Inner Dimensions : 30W x 30D x 20H cms.
Transfer Time : 30 / 60 seconds.
Operating Voltage : 230V AC / 440V
Temp. Control : PID temp. controller for Hot chamber, Cold Chamber & cascade system.

Optional:
Microprocessor based PID temp. control with printer interface
GMP Model complete SS Unit

Safety Features:
Circuit breakers & cutouts for over & under temp. Conditions. HRC fuses for compressors, Heaters & mains

Special Care :
To be kept in temp. of 25 °C  ± 2 °C  rooms & Servo Controlled Voltage Stabilizer is recommended.
